Peres: I proved to myself that I deserve a place in Formula 1.

      Sergio Perez believes that in the early races of the 2026 season, he demonstrated that he is still one of the best modern Formula 1 drivers. However, the mistakes made by Cadillac during the race weekends, due to the team's lack of experience, prevent the Mexican driver from fully realizing his potential.

      Sergio Perez: "I think we still lack efficiency in the team's work, and we are not achieving the progress we could be making. Therefore, we need to focus on maximizing the potential of the car.

      Right now, I am frustrated precisely because of how the team is functioning. We need to improve this very urgently because we are not achieving the best possible results. But the team is making progress in this direction, and that is very positive. However, in terms of organizational work, we are still seriously lagging behind, and we need to find a solution before the start of the European part of the season in Monaco.

      I am very satisfied with my performances and my level of driving. I am glad that I returned and proved to myself that I still deserve a place among the best. I really enjoy what I do, and I am very pleased with how I am driving right now."

      Sergio Perez and Cadillac have not yet scored points, but the driver hopes he will have chances in Monaco: "Monaco always has special races. Anything can happen there, so I hope we can perform strongly."
